hi all, thinking of doing the same to my nc29 she seems flat at the down,
question is which way do you screw the screw in to richen it up as you look at the screw if you know what i mean.......
also does the setting of this mixture screw effect the mixture throuout the rev range.

screw in for leaner. Out is richer. Only adjusts up to quarter throttle.for that you need to change needle and main jet settings. :grin:

it effects the whole rev range to a degree, but use it to adjust the idel- 1/4 throttle spot on and then change other jetting independantly.
